I read a dicom image which has 128 rows and 128 columns, a depth of 1, and each dicom has 72 frames. Like this 72 images
X(128,128,1,72);
Now I need to convert this four-dimensional variable to a 3 dimensional variable for doing volume rendering using isosurface. How do I reduce this dimension by using reshape or squeeze? Can any one help me?
